Ethnocentrism is best defined as:
A) the belief that you should suspend judgment when learning a new culture
B) the belief that your own culture is better than another
C) the belief that your ethnic group should be first among subcultures
D) the practice of ethnicity within a state society
Ethnocentrism
The belief in the inherent superiority of one's own ethnic group or culture over others.

Final Answer :
B
Explanation :
Ethnocentrism is the belief that one's own culture is superior to others. This can lead to a biased view of other cultures and a lack of understanding and respect for their customs and beliefs. It is important to recognize and address one's own ethnocentric biases in order to foster intercultural understanding and communication.
